Dear Chairman Schmidt:
Thank you for your service to the State of Texas and your work on the Texas Racing
Commission.
I am very hopeful about your upcoming Commission meeting scheduled for December 15,
2015, because you and your fellow Commissioners have an opportunity to address an important
issue.
As I have previously stated, I believe the decision to publish rules for the implementation of
historical racing was not an appropriate action for the Commission. The move runs afoul of the
Texas Constitution and the express desire of many members of the Texas Legislature, including
me.
I ask that you take this opportunity to unwind historical racing and return the Commission
to its statutory purpose of enforcing the Texas Racing Act and its rules to ensure the safety,
integrity, and fairness of Texas pari-mutuel racing. Additionally, I am committed to gathering
stakeholders together – horse breeders, trainers, and other associated and affiliated agri-business
– to find ways to improve opportunities outside of expanding the gambling footprint in Texas. I
want to restore certainty and predictability to the industry and allow them to prosper moving
forward.
The equine industry has a long and storied history in Texas, and I look forward to this
opportunity to work together to ensure their long term success.
